Lets compare vitamin content per 1 kilogram of Cooked Ripe Red Tomatoes vs Golden Delicious Apples:
- 1 kilogram of Cooked Ripe Red Tomatoes has 8 times more Vitamin A, 2 times more Vitamin B1, 5.7 times more Vitamin B3, 1.7 times more Vitamin B5, 1.5 times more Vitamin B6, 4.3 times more Vitamin B9, 3.1 times more Vitamin E and 1.6 times more Vitamin K than Golden Delicious Apples.
- 1 kilogram of Cooked Ripe Red Tomatoes have insufficient amounts of Vitamin B2
- 1 kilogram of Golden Delicious Apples have insufficient amounts of Vitamin A, Vitamin B1, Vitamin B3, Vitamin B5, Vitamin B9, Vitamin E and Vitamin K
Comparing minerals per 1 kilogram for Cooked Ripe Red Tomatoes vs Golden Delicious Apples:
- 1 kilogram of Cooked Ripe Red Tomatoes has 2.5 times more Copper, 5.2 times more Iron, 1.8 times more Magnesium, 3 times more Manganese, 2.8 times more Phosphorus and 2.2 times more Potassium than Golden Delicious Apples.
- Both Cooked Ripe Red Tomatoes and Golden Delicious Apples contain similar levels of Water per one kilogram.
- 1 kilogram of Golden Delicious Apples lack sufficient amounts of Iron, Magnesium, Manganese and Phosphorus
- Both Cooked Ripe Red Tomatoes as well as Raw Golden Delicious Apples with skin lack sufficient amounts of Calcium, Selenium and Zinc in one kilogram.
Comparison of macro-nutrients per 1 kilogram:
- 1 kg of Raw Golden Delicious Apples with skin contains 3.4 times more Carbohydrate, 4 times more Sugars, 4.7 times more Fructose and 3.4 times more Fiber than Cooked Ripe Red Tomatoes.
- 1 kilogram of Cooked Ripe Red Tomatoes provide inadequate amounts of Fiber
- Both Cooked Ripe Red Tomatoes as well as Raw Golden Delicious Apples with skin provide inadequate amounts of Energy and Protein in one kilogram.
